U.S. Benefits Design & Strategy- Benefits Strategy, Associate

Jersey City, NJ

The JPMorgan Chase U.S. Benefits Design and Strategy team is responsible for evaluating and implementing changes to various benefit programs (e.g., medical, dental, vision, 401(k), life insurance, long-term disability), monitoring plan performance, regulations and marketplace trends, and taking an active part in the design and implementation of the firm's overall wellness initiatives. The JPMC Medical Plan and Wellness Program is designed to meet the needs of over 150,000 U.S. employees and is recognized for its commitment to employee health and well-being.

As the Benefits Strategy Associate you will work with the Benefits Strategy Manager and other team members on strategic initiatives in the U.S. healthcare space. Initiatives include evaluation and implementation of potential new offerings and enhancements to the JPMC U.S. benefits program. The role may also involve assisting in, and developing a working knowledge of, the existing benefit plans.

Some recent initiatives: Designing a new medical plan and wellness program, enhancing family building benefits, enhancing gender affirming benefits, and launching a virtual advanced primary care solution.

Job responsibilities

  • Gathering research on market trends and synthesizing benchmarking information
  • Conducting vendor due diligence, including evaluating responses from Requests for Proposal / Requests for Information
  • Developing presentations for senior management review and approval
  • Assisting with implementation efforts (e.g., project managing across internal and external vendors, drafting/reviewing communications materials and intranet content, assisting with contracting efforts, coordinating with vendors)
  • Partnering with internal stakeholders including Morgan Health, Wellness, Benefits Delivery & Customer Service, Benefits Data Analysis/Reporting, Communications, Legal, Sourcing, Technology, IT Security, Finance, Corporate Strategy

Required qualifications, capabilities, and skills

  • Bachelors degree
  • Minimum 3+ years experience in a strategy or U.S. benefits role
  • Experience working in a strategic, analytical or metric driven position
  • Strong verbal and written communication skills
  • Strong analytical and problem-solving skills
  • Strong project management skills, with a high level of attention to detail
  • Ability to multi-task, work independently, meet deadlines, and manage multiple deliverables
  • Solid knowledge of standard desktop applications: MS Office, Powerpoint, Excel
